Della Parola Risk Optimized Equity Fund
A series of M3Sixty Funds Trust
Supplement dated November 20, 2017
to the Prospectus and Statement of Additional Information
each dated February 6, 2017
The Board of Trustees (the “Board”) of the M3Sixty Funds Trust (the “Trust”) has approved a Plan of Liquidation (the “Plan”) relating to the Della Parola Risk Optimized Equity Fund (the “Fund”), effective November 20, 2017. Della Parola Capital Management, LLC, the Fund’s investment adviser (the “Adviser”), has recommended to the Board to approve the Plan based on its financial constraints and its inability to continue meeting its obligations to support the Fund. As a result, the Board has concluded that it is in the best interest of the shareholders to liquidate the Fund.
In connection with the proposed liquidation and dissolution of the Fund called for by the Plan, the Board has directed the Trust’s principal underwriter to cease offering shares of the Fund. Shareholders may continue to reinvest dividends and distributions in the Fund or redeem their shares until the liquidation.
It is anticipated that the Fund will liquidate on or about November 20, 2017. Any remaining shareholders on the date of liquidation will receive a distribution of their remaining investment value in full liquidation of the Fund. IMPORTANT INFORMATION FOR RETIREMENT PLAN INVESTORS
If you are a retirement plan investor, you should consult your tax advisor regarding the consequences of any redemption of Fund shares. If you receive a distribution from an Individual Retirement Account or a Simplified Employee Pension (SEP) IRA, you must roll the proceeds into another Individual Retirement Account within sixty (60) days of the date of the distribution in order to avoid having to include the distribution in your taxable income for the year. If you receive a distribution from a 403(b)(7) Custodian Account (Tax-Sheltered account) or a Keogh Account, you must roll the distribution into a similar type of retirement plan within sixty (60) days in order to avoid disqualification of your plan and the severe tax consequences that it can bring. If you are the trustee of a Qualified Retirement Plan, you may reinvest the money in any way permitted by the plan and trust agreement.
